Engine 52-1 Handles RIT Response to Pocopson Township House Fire
 
By Third Class Firefighter Dave Smiley Jr.
January 10, 2017
 

At 4:30PM on Tuesday, January 10, Station 52 was alerted to respond as the RIT (rapid intervention team) on the house fire assignment to the 1600 block of Washington Lane in Pocopson Township. Engine 52-1 responded shortly after dispatch with a crew of five, and arrived shortly after initial units confirmed a working fire. Engine 25-1, Engine 36, Engine 51-2, and Ladder 25 arrived and went inservice with fire suppression. The Engine crew then stood by as the RIT until being released by command about 45 minutes later.
